  2. Stéphane Foenkinos was born on 27 October 1968 in Paris, France. He is a casting director and actor, known for Midnight in Paris (2011), Allied (2016) and Delicacy (2011).

  4. Mar 23, 2023 · Designed by Stéphane Foenkinos and Pierre-Alain Giraud,* this journey into the history of the civil rights movement in the United States is a gripping experience. "Noire" won the award for Best Film in the first-ever Immersive Competition in Cannes 2024.
